Eligibility and Admission Process for taking admission in the Master of Computer Applications (MCA) course at Chandigarh University:
Candidate must pass graduation like BCA, B.Sc (IT/CS), B.Tech (CSE/IT) or any degree with Maths/Stats/Programming/Business Maths at 10+2 or graduation level.
To apply, a student must have a graduation degree such as BCA, B.Sc in IT or Computer Science, B.Tech in CSE/IT, or any other degree with Maths, Statistics, Business Maths, or Programming studied either in 12th class or during graduation. No, Chandigarh University does not require a valid GATE Exam 2026 score for any M.E. specialisation. This applies to all core engineering branches and interdisciplinary programs.
